National Intercollegiate Rodeo Foundation is located in Walla Walla, WA.
For the year ending 06/2023, National Intercollegiate Rodeo Foundation generated $224.1k in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 7 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 0.6%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$154.4k during the year ending 06/2023.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.
Since 2015, National Intercollegiate Rodeo Foundation has awarded 361 individual grants totaling $605,050.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
